- Founded in New York in 2005, and subsequently established in Hong Kong, in 2007, ESKYIU is a multi-disciplinary studio that explores how architecture intersects with transformative cultural landscapes, media, products, print, experimental fabrication systems, educational tools, and social sustainability.

This First Projects talk will focus on those aspects of social, technological and environmental change as they relate to the built environment, especially as to how architects might seek to expand their role beyond disciplinary boundaries, benefit from collaborations with experts in other fields, and take a hands-on approach to design and implementation.

During such times ESKYIU studio staying positive and hopeful for all things creative and cultural.
“EVERYDAY HERITAGE” 2019/2020 reflects on the original buildings that once stood on site, against the backdrop of the rich history of North Point that surrounds the fabric of the city. The original buildings had the Chinese characters “吉祥大樓一九六零年營建” on the walls of the small former residential workshop. “Lucky Tower built in the year 1960” – these new furniture objects are designed and created by ESKYIU co-founders: .yiu and with their team, they repurposed the terrazzo pieces and tiling to present its history as a poetic tribute to the past. Encased in glass, the colours change along different lighting conditions. As an extension, the dichroic glass material weaves through the entire building vertically, integrating art, heritage and architecture for functional everyday use.
